Don’t Just Be Positive, Be Constructive
There was an article on Babble the other day entitled Using Positive Statements to Help Toddlers Obey. The gist of it was that you should use (you guessed it) “positive” statements to instruct your toddler instead of “negative” statements. Eg, say “Stay in your seat,” instead of “Don’t stand up,” or, “Put your hands at your sides,” instead of,…
